be an error, however, to look upon these different kinds of metabolism
as quite independent. Considering the close correlation which all the
phases of metabolism bear to each other, this idea cannot well be
entertained. If, however, we question in what manner, for instance,
the functional and the cytoplastic metabolism are linked together, we
have a problem before us which does not belong to the past, but to the
present and future. Indeed, _Virchow_ seems already to have felt that
a sharp division between the different phases and parts of functional
metabolism in the cell does not exist, for he says: “It is true
that it cannot be denied that, especially between the nutritive and
formative processes and likewise between the functional and nutritive,
intermediate gradations occur.” Still they differ essentially in
their characteristic action and in the internal alterations which
the stimulated part undergoes, depending on whether it functionates,
nourishes itself, or is the seat of special growth. Disease consists of
the influence of stimuli upon these physiological processes. The law
of the specific energy of living substance is as clearly expressed in
functional disease as it is in the physiological effects of stimuli.
The pathological disturbance of function is purely quantitative,
“nowhere is there a qualitative divergence.” The function exists or
it does _not_ exist. If it is present, it is either strengthened or
weakened. This gives the three fundamental forms of disturbance:
absence, weakening and strengthening of the function. No function
other than the physiological, even under the greatest pathological
alterations, exists in any _structure_ of the body. “The muscle does
_not_ perceive, the nerve moves no bone, the cartilage does not think.”
In this way _Virchow_ rediscovered in the domain of pathology the
law that his great teacher, _Johannes Müller_, had already clearly
established in the field of physiology. But this law can no longer be
applied to all pathological disturbances of the nutritive and formative
activities of the cell. Here processes occur which do not consist of
a quantitative change of the normal phenomena, but in the appearance
of wholly foreign states, as in the case of amyloid degeneration or
heteroplastic tumors. The question today and for the future arises,
therefore, as to where the limits of the validity of the law of the
specific energy of living substances are to be placed, a question
closely connected with the other before mentioned, of the relations
between functional and cytoplastic metabolism.
